The Growing Focus on Responsible Gambling
Regulatory frameworks like the GlüStV and OASIS are driving a greater emphasis on responsible gambling. Features like self-exclusion tools and deposit limits are becoming more prevalent, aiming to mitigate the risks associated with problem gambling. Approximately 4% of players utilize self-exclusion tools, highlighting the need for these safeguards.

The Impact of RTP and House Edge
Understanding Return to Player (RTP) percentages and the house edge is critical. Even with high RTPs, like 98%, the mathematical expectation remains negative for the player. This means that over the long term, the casino is statistically likely to profit.

Q: What is provably fair gaming?
A: Provably fair gaming uses cryptographic algorithms to allow players to verify the fairness of each game outcome.
